Abstract
The utility model discloses a computer -controlled agricultural irrigation equipment, the water tank sets up on moving platform, the immersible pump sets up the bottom at the water tank, the level gauge sets up at the bottom of water tank intermediate position, the computer facility is at the top of water tank, the immersible pump passes through the raceway and is connected with Y shape irrigation equipment, electromagnetism main valve, manometer, filter and flowmeter from left to right set gradually on the raceway, Y shape irrigation equipment include atomizer, emitter and spray the shower nozzle, atomizer and emitter set up and prop up on Y shape irrigation equipment, the bottom suspension of shower nozzle setting at Y shape irrigation equipment spray, atomizer, emitter and the left side that sprays the shower nozzle all are provided with the electromagnetism and divide the valve, solenoid valve, electromagnetism divide valve, level gauge, flowmeter, manometer, immersible pump all with computer electric connection. This computer -controlled agricultural irrigation equipment simple structure can irrigate by automatic control.
Description
Technical field
The utility model belongs to irrigation installation technical field, is specifically related to a kind of computer-controlled agricultural irrigation equipment.
Background technology
Along with the fast development of China's economic, development also very rapid of agricultural, to the demand of agricultural irrigation equipment very large.If the agricultural irrigation equipment do not had, just will slattern a large amount of water resources.The agricultural irrigation device category of existing market is many, substantially demand is met, but also there are some problems, such as irrigation method is more single, can not need to convert Different Irrigation Methods according to difference, the a large amount of valuable water resource of so great waste, too increases operation cost simultaneously; Moreover be exactly need traditional Non-follow control, do not arrange calculator and carry out scientific and reasonable control, efficiency comparison is low, can not realize the accurate control to irrigation installation, and Non-follow control can often occur some mistakes.Therefore a kind of agricultural irrigation equipment is needed.
Utility model content
The purpose of this utility model is to provide a kind of computer-controlled agricultural irrigation equipment, to solve the problem proposed in above-mentioned background technology.
For achieving the above object, the utility model provides following technical scheme: a kind of computer-controlled agricultural irrigation equipment, comprises mobile platform, water tank, immersible pump, calculator, electromagnetism main valve, manometer, filter, liquid level gauge, flowmeter, Y shape irrigation rig, described water tank is arranged on a mobile platform, and described immersible pump is arranged on the bottom of water tank, described liquid level gauge is arranged on the centre position, bottom of water tank, described computer installation is at the top of water tank, and described immersible pump is connected with Y shape irrigation rig by water-supply-pipe, described electromagnetism main valve, manometer, filter and flowmeter are from left to right successively set on water-supply-pipe, and described Y shape irrigation rig comprises atomizer, emitter and spray nozzle, described atomizer and emitter be arranged on Y shape irrigation rig upper, described spray nozzle is arranged on lower of Y shape irrigation rig, described atomizer, the left side of emitter and spray nozzle is provided with electromagnetism and divides valve, described magnetic valve, electromagnetism divides valve, liquid level gauge, flowmeter, manometer, immersible pump is all electrically connected with calculator.
Preferably, the inside of described filter is provided with multistage filtering net.
Preferably, described mobile platform is provided with power set.
Preferably, described atomizer, emitter and spray nozzle all arrange 4-6 group.
Technique effect of the present utility model and advantage: this computer-controlled agricultural irrigation device structure is simple, can control irrigation automatically; The atomizer arranged, emitter and spray nozzle, can need to select different sprinkling irrigation modes according to difference, saves water resource to greatest extent, the scope be simultaneously suitable for very extensive; Owing to being provided with calculator, timing can be realized, quantitative water supply is irrigated, compared with Non-follow control, operating cost can be reduced, using water wisely, can control whole irrigation installation simultaneously accurately, can carry out irrigation operation automatically according to the numerical value of setting and sprinkling irrigation mode, save a large amount of labours, it also avoid the mistake that Artificial Control occurs simultaneously.
